Freezing smoked fish ?
« on: November 09, 2018, 04:21:01 PM »
I have been told not to freeze it. Never had enough to worry about as it gets eaten pretty fast. I am wanting to smoke up some before the cold sets in and the Little Chief gets put away for winter, gonna happen pretty quick I think. What I have been told was that if you froze it, It will break down during the thaw and turn to crap due to the brine and smoke ? I vacuum pack so I don't think it should be a big deal. Your thought or experiences ?

I freeze lots of it. I wrap the smoked  fish in saran wrap and then vaccume pack it. Lasts for years and you cant tell the difference once you pull it out.
